Transaction 183680761403323d6677f6c52d46f702917e20f73f96aa8c085adf0d17abf6f2
1 Input
1 Output
-
183680761403323d6677f6c52d46f702917e20f73f96aa8c085adf0d17abf6f2:0
- value
- 9645296
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 31dfdb11feecb4fa2dd0e5198a59a73506d3beba OP_EQUALVERIFY OP_CHECKSIG
- address
- 15YiHApuhyTVj1FYkiPtAN4FgMsf2Pkk2u